About

Doom II: Hell on Earth, released in 1994, is a classic first-person shooter developed by id Software, following the success of its predecessor, Doom. The game features fast-paced combat and intricately designed levels where players take on demonic forces invading Earth. Its notable blend of maze-like exploration and a diverse arsenal of weapons ensures that players are constantly engaged, solidifying its status as a seminal title in the FPS genre.
